What are the technical characteristics of the ICT XBA bill validator with 400-note stacker, 34V, STD bezel?
The ICT XBA bill validator with 400-note stacker, 34V, STD bezel is a high-performance bill validator with an MDB interface, designed for demanding cash handling applications. Its advanced optical and mechanical design, wide note insertion angle and automatic calibration work together to deliver high acceptance rates and low error levels in day-to-day operation.
- product name: ICT XBA bill validator with 400-note stacker, 34V, STD bezel, order code: ICTXBA34DNMEU4,
- category: bill validator with integrated 400-note stacker,
- interface: mdb communication protocol for vending and payment systems,
- note insertion: uniquely wide note insertion angle for user-friendly operation,
- acceptance rate: 98 percent or higher with fast note-to-note processing,
- optical system: auto-calibration and multi-colour optical sensor technology,
- light immunity: high level of protection against strong ambient light sources,
- anti-fraud features: enhanced optical and mechanical protection to reduce manipulation attempts,
- firmware update: on-board usb port for convenient updates via usb flash drive,
- additional update options: mdb-ftl and irda firmware update capability,
- reliability: m.t.b.f. of around 750,000 cycles,
- environmental robustness: excellent tolerance of harsh weather conditions,
- energy saving: integrated power save function,
- stacker capacity: standard cashbox with around 400-note capacity,
- weight: approximately 2.1 kg per unit,
- typical use: vending and payment machines, parking systems, gaming and amusement devices handling cash.

FAQ – questions about ICT XBA bill validators
What are the advantages of a wide note insertion angle?
A wide note insertion angle makes it easier for users to feed notes correctly, which leads to smoother transactions and fewer insertion errors at the machine.
Why is multi-colour optical sensing useful in a bill validator?
Multi-colour optical sensing captures more detailed information about each note, improving counterfeit detection and reducing the likelihood of rejecting genuine currency.
How does auto-calibration help in everyday operation?
Auto-calibration keeps the sensor performance stable over time and compensates for environmental changes, which reduces the need for manual adjustments and service calls.
When is a 400-note stacker the right capacity?
A 400-note stacker is a good choice for medium to high cash volumes where you want to reduce the frequency of cash collection visits and keep machines available for longer.
